What did Marques de Rubi think should be done with the presidios in Texas and how did his report impact the Spanish
yan [13]

Answer:

1.  The specific factors that caused Marque´s de Rubi to abandon East Texas are:

a.  Presidios were not thriving

b.   Missions were not thriving.

c.  Only La Bahia and San Antonio de Bexar missions were growing.

d.  Spain had low power, capital, and people necessary to hold a vast area.

2.  The primary goal of the mission is to spread Christianity while they settle, however, due to the hostile nature of the natives and geographical barriers, the situation on the ground did not serve the primary situation of the Spanish settlers.

Which of the following U.S. Cold War policies was most motivated by American leaders belief in the domino theory?
BartSMP [9]

The correct answer is "A".

The Domino Theory was developed in 1950 in the US administration. It proposed the idea that if one country in a region was governed by a left-wing power which shared communist beliefs, neighbor countries will follow suit.  This led the United States to get involved in numerous armed conflicts around the world, such as the Korean War, in order to prevent the spread of Communism.
